How to Make Baked Salmon with Amazing Lemon Sauce

  1. Preheat Oven: Begin by setting your oven to 400 °F (205 °C). This will ensure your salmon cooks evenly and achieves that perfect flaky texture.

  2. Prepare Vegetables: Wash and chop your potatoes and broccoli. Toss them with a drizzle of olive oil, salt, and pepper to enhance their natural flavors.

  3. Arrange on Sheet Pan: Spread the potatoes on one side of a baking sheet and arrange the broccoli on the other. Bake them for 15 minutes, allowing them to get crispy and golden.

  4. Add Salmon: After the initial bake, place the seasoned salmon fillets on the sheet pan. Return it to the oven and cook for another 15-20 minutes until the salmon is cooked through and flakes easily with a fork.

  5. Make Lemon Sauce: In a pan, saut the shallots in a splash of olive oil until translucent. Add the fresh thyme, then pour in the heavy cream and lemon juice. Simmer until the sauce thickens, about 5 minutes.

  6. Serve: Plate your beautifully baked salmon alongside the golden potatoes and vibrant broccoli. Generously drizzle that amazing lemon sauce over the top for an extra burst of flavor!

Optional: Garnish with fresh parsley for an added pop of color and freshness.

How to Store and Freeze Baked Salmon with Amazing Lemon Sauce

Fridge: Store leftover baked salmon with amazing lemon sauce in an airtight container for up to 3 days. This ensures optimal flavor and freshness while preventing drying out.

Freezer: If you wish to freeze, let the salmon cool completely, wrap tightly in plastic wrap, and then place it in a freezer-safe bag for up to 2 months. To reheat, thaw in the fridge overnight.

Reheating: Gently reheat salmon and lemon sauce on low in a skillet, adding a splash of water or cream to the sauce to restore its creamy consistency for a delectable experience.

Avoid Room Temperature: Do not leave cooked salmon at room temperature for more than 2 hours to ensure food safety and maintain quality.

Expert Tips for Baked Salmon

  • Freshness Matters: Always use fresh or properly thawed salmon for the best texture and flavor in your baked salmon with amazing lemon sauce.

  • Watch the Timer: Keep an eye on the salmon while it cooks; overcooking can lead to dryness. Check for doneness by flaking with a fork.

  • Perfect Thickness: Aim for fillets about 1-inch thick for even cooking. Thinner pieces may dry out, while thicker ones may need more time.

  • Creamy Sauce Consistency: The lemon sauce thickens as it sits; serve immediately for the best velvety texture and full flavor.

Baked Salmon with Amazing Lemon Sauce Recipe FAQs

What type of salmon should I use for the best flavor?
For the best results, I recommend using fresh or properly thawed wild-caught salmon. This type tends to have a richer flavor and a firmer texture, ensuring your baked salmon with amazing lemon sauce turns out perfect every time.

How should I store leftover baked salmon with amazing lemon sauce?
Store your leftover salmon in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. It s essential to keep it tightly sealed to maintain its moisture and flavor. If you don t plan to eat it quickly, consider reviving it with a little splash of water when reheating.

Can I freeze baked salmon, and if so, how?
Absolutely! First, allow the salmon to cool completely. Then, wrap each piece tightly in plastic wrap, ensuring there s no exposure to air. Place the wrapped salmon in a freezer-safe bag or container, and it will stay safe for about 2 months. When you re ready to enjoy it, thaw it in the refrigerator overnight before reheating.

What should I do if my lemon sauce is too thick?
If you find that your lemon sauce has thickened too much, don t worry! Simply add a splash of water or a bit more heavy cream, and stir on low heat until you reach your desired consistency. This way, you can enjoy that velvety texture you love.

Can I make this recipe dairy-free?
Yes, definitely! To make the sauce dairy-free, substitute the heavy cream with coconut cream. This will keep the richness while offering a delightful twist to the flavor profile. Just make sure to use fresh lemon juice for that zesty kick!
